We don't know all the particulars for how they're going to implement the decay timer (if it is indeed even a decay timer) on housing. The first time SE tried to do this the community got very riled up because the rules were a bit too strict. I think you had to set foot in the property at least once in less than 30 days. This wasn't a great rule set and hopefully they'll come out with something a bit more realistic; anywhere in the vicinity of 6 months would work. If a player can't log into the game in more than half a year I'm sorry but they shouldn't retain their house.
Many players that agree with the stance of a decay timer own property of various sizes and recognize the necessity of it. Wards are a constantly loaded resource which means they add to server strain. From a business perspective it doesn't make any sense for SE to keep adding more wards while, in the meantime, half of the houses per ward sit vacant. They're essentially paying server fees for players who aren't paying them (subscription fee). This also leads to dead wards.
While I agree that SE needs to look into server upgrades, the steps they are going to implement with their current housing system make total sense. SE has no idea if/when those inactive players will even come back, and as such, no inactive player should be able to indefinitely hold an active resource from active players.
